AI Verdict

INV BEARISH

The company exhibits severe financial distress, highlighted by a Piotroski F-Score of 1/9, indicating critical weakness in fundamental health. While revenue growth is robust at 80.30%, the valuation is disconnected from reality with a Price/Sales ratio of 169.02 and a catastrophic operating margin of -3859.12%. Despite a 'strong_buy' analyst consensus from a very small sample, heavy insider selling of $10.16M and a bearish technical trend suggest a high-risk speculative environment.

Strengths
Strong year-over-year revenue growth of 80.30%
Low Debt/Equity ratio of 0.07
Positive short-term price momentum (1M change +30.1%)
Risks
Extreme valuation with a Price/Sales ratio of 169.02
Severe operational inefficiency (Operating Margin -3859.12%)
Critical financial health as evidenced by Piotroski F-Score of 1/9
MIY BEARISH

MIY exhibits a stable financial health profile with a Piotroski F-Score of 6/9, but is fundamentally undermined by unsustainable dividend practices and poor technical momentum. The fund is trading at $11.99, significantly above its Graham Number of $9.75 and far exceeding its growth-based intrinsic value of $2.38. A critical red flag is the payout ratio of 192.35%, indicating that dividends are not being covered by earnings. With a technical trend score of 0/100 and weak insider sentiment, the asset lacks both fundamental value support and market momentum.

Strengths
Stable Piotroski F-Score (6/9) indicating consistent financial health
Trading at a slight discount to book value (P/B 0.97)
Strong current and quick ratios (>3.0) suggesting high liquidity
Risks
Unsustainable payout ratio of 192.35% suggesting potential dividend cuts
Severe technical bearishness (Trend Score: 0/100)
Significant premium over intrinsic value ($2.38) and Graham Number ($9.75)
